If you listen to Donald Trump's speeches, it's all about deals. So how will this play out in the world of international diplomacy?
Jon Sopel talks to Steven Erlanger, New York Times London bureau chief, about how the world is bracing for a Trump presidency, and who says,"Everyone is very anxious and some countries are angry and in general everyone is holding their breath and saying to themselves, oh it'll be all right, because he's just a Twitter nut and it's not policy yet."
Also on the programme: can Donald Trump unite the United States?
